TUNDRA
The Tundra is a large biome that is largely treeless and extremely cold.
It stretches out over North America , Europe & Asia.
Permafrost a permanently frozen layer of soil under the surface , characterizes the Tundra.
The tundra gets very little precipitation and has very short growing seasons as long two months. Leaving it to have small plants such as grasses , sedges , and mosses are the most common.
